Device Monitoring with aiu-smi
Stack: torch-spyre (new, Inductor-based).
aiu-smi is a command-line monitoring tool for Spyre devices. It
reads hardware performance counters and periodically prints metrics
such as PT-array utilization, power, temperature, device-memory and
PCIe bandwidth. No code changes are needed in the workload.
For the full metric list, CLI flags, and output format, consult the
tool directly — aiu-smi --help or aiu-smi dmon --help.
Install
aiu-monitor ships as a pre-built wheel from your internal IBM package
mirror. Ask your Spyre enablement contact for the mirror location and
access. The steps here describe the install pattern. They do not pin a
specific URL.
Wheel versions, package names, Python tags, and supported architectures
change over time, so browse the live package index before you copy an
install command. The wheels are organised as
<arch>/{stable,dev}/<version>/<wheel>.whl. Pick the wheel that matches
your CPU architecture and the Python version of your venv. The wheel
filename encodes both (e.g. ibm_aiu_monitor-...-py312-none-linux_x86_64.whl).
Prefer the stable/ channel. A dev/ channel exists per arch for
chasing a fix that has not reached stable/ yet.
Install with the URL or local path your mirror provides, for example:
# x86_64, Python 3.12, torch-spyre-tagged build
uv pip install <mirror>/aiu-monitor/x86_64/stable/<version>/ibm_aiu_monitor-<version>+torch.spyre-py312-none-linux_x86_64.whl
uv pip install psutil
Two-terminal workflow
aiu-smi runs in its own shell alongside the workload.
Workload shell:
export DTCOMPILER_KEEP_EXPORT=true
export SENLIB_DEVEL_CONFIG_FILE=<path-to-venv>/etc/senlib_config_aiusmi.json
python my_workload.py
aiu-smi shell:
export DEEPRT_EXPORT_DIR=<workload-directory>
aiu-smi
